Integration Manual
ID TECH VP3350 User Manual
Page | 4
Table of Contents
1. INTRODUCTION................................................................................................................................................... 5
2. MAJOR VP3350 FEATURES .................................................................................................................................. 5
2.1. Contactless NFC Features and Brand Certifications ................................................................................. 5
2.2. Other Agency Approvals and Compliances ............................................................................................... 6
2.3. Operation and Storage: Environmental Limits ......................................................................................... 6
2.4. Power Consumption ................................................................................................................................. 6
2.5. 24-Hour Device Reboot ............................................................................................................................ 6
3. VP3350 CONNECTORS AND INTERFACES ............................................................................................................ 7
4. BLUETOOTH PAIRING INSTRUCTIONS ................................................................................................................. 8
4.1. Battery Charging Instructions ................................................................................................................... 9
4.2. VP3350 LED and Sound State Indicators .................................................................................................. 9
4.3. Tamper and Failed Self-Check Indicators ............................................................................................... 10
4.4. iOS Connectivity: BLE and VP3350 .......................................................................................................... 10
5. ID TECH UNIVERSAL SDK ................................................................................................................................... 10
5.1. Updating VP3350 Firmware.................................................................................................................... 11
6. UNIVERSAL SDK DEMO APP .............................................................................................................................. 12
6.1. Using the Demo Application ................................................................................................................... 12
7. VP3350 LOW-LEVEL COMMANDS ..................................................................................................................... 13
7.1. Activate Transaction Command (02-40) ................................................................................................. 13
7.2. Set CA Public Key (D0-03) ....................................................................................................................... 14
7.3. Get Processor Type (09-02) .................................................................................................................... 15
7.4. Get Main Firmware Version (09-03) ....................................................................................................... 16
7.5. Get Hardware Information (09-14)......................................................................................................... 16
7.6. Get Module Version Information (09-20) ............................................................................................... 18
7.7. Get Serial Number (12-01) ...................................................................................................................... 19
7.8. Contact Set ICS Identification (60-16)..................................................................................................... 20
7.9. Contact Set Terminal Data (60-06) ......................................................................................................... 21
7.10. Contact Set Application Data (60-03) ................................................................................................... 26
8. BASIC CARD READING DATA FLOW................................................................................................................... 29
8.1. Example: Reading a Card via Firmware Commands ............................................................................... 29
8.2. Example: Reading a Card via Universal SDK Methods ............................................................................ 29
8.3. Example: Reading a Card via the USDK Demo App ................................................................................. 29
9. PERIODIC INSPECTION INSTRUCTIONS ............................................................................................................. 29
10. DECOMMISSIONING PCI-CERTIFIED DEVICES ................................................................................................. 30
11. TROUBLESHOOTING ....................................................................................................................................... 31
11.1. Tamper Detection Codes ...................................................................................................................... 32
12. FOR MORE INFORMATION.............................................................................................................................. 33